Washington Adventist University is located in Takoma Park, Maryland and has a total student population of 968. In the 2020-2021 academic year, 1 student received a bachelor's degree in phys ed from Washington Adventist University.

Careers That Phys Ed Grads May Go Into

A degree in phys ed can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for MD, the home state for Washington Adventist University.

Occupation Jobs in MD Average Salary in MD
Fitness Trainers and Aerobics Instructors 7,560 $46,270
Coaches and Scouts 3,880 $43,790
Athletic Trainers 390 $51,820
Athletes and Sports Competitors 230 $50,250
Recreation and Fitness Studies Professors 130 $68,540
